And "packageresources" (http://www.handshake.de/~dieter/pyprojects/packageresources.tgz" can show a way to do it. An alternative could be the upcoming egg's support for egg local resources. With "packageresources" a python package/module is identified by an url of the form "pypackage:<module_path>", e.g. "pypackage:Products.CMFCore" or "pypackage:Shared.DC.ZRDB.DA". A resource (e.g. a file or directory) local to a package is identified by an url "pypackage:<package_path>/<package_relative_file_path>", e.g. "pypackage:Products.CMFCore/skins" As you can see: this allows to specifiy location independent skin directories. -- Dieter _______________________________________________ Zope-CMF maillist - Zope-CMF@lists.zope.org http://mail.zope.org/mailman/listinfo/zope-cmf See http://collector.zope.org/CMF for bug reports and feature requests
